A, B & C form the vertices of a triangle, where ∠CAB = 90°.
AB = 10.2 m and AC = 5.6 m.
Evaluate ∠CBA, giving your answer rounded to 3 SF.

The unknown angle of the right triangle is as follows:

∠CBA = 28.8°

How to find the angle of a right triangle?

The triangle is a right triangle because one of its angle is equals to 90 degrees.

The angle  ∠CBA, can be found using trigonometric rations,

hence,

tan ∅ = opposite / adjacent

where

∅ = ∠CBA

Therefore,

tan ∠CBA = opposite / adjacent

opposite side = 5.6 m

adjacent side = 10.2 m

Hence,

tan ∠CBA = 5.6 / 10.2

tan ∠CBA = 0.54901960784

∠CBA = tan⁻¹ 0.54901960784

∠CBA = 28.7676493388

∠CBA = 28.8°
